Exploring the Current and Future of the Stem Cell Umbilical Cord Blood Market


Stem Cell Umbilical Cord Blood refers to the hematopoietic stem cells found in the blood of the umbilical cord and placenta after childbirth, which can be collected and stored for future medical use. These stem cells have the potential to treat various diseases, including blood disorders like leukemia and certain genetic conditions. The market for Stem Cell Umbilical Cord Blood is significant as it addresses the growing need for alternative therapies and regenerative medicine, driven by advancements in medical research and a rising prevalence of chronic diseases.

Stem Cell Umbilical Cord Blood Market Segmentation for period from 2024 to 2031


The Stem Cell Umbilical Cord Blood Market Analysis by types is segmented into:


  • Public Cord Blood Banks
  • Private Cord Blood Banks


The stem cell umbilical cord blood market consists of two main types: public and private cord blood banks. Public cord blood banks collect and store donated umbilical cord blood for altruistic purposes, making it available for patients in need of stem cell transplants. In contrast, private cord blood banks allow families to store their newborn's cord blood for personal use, primarily for potential future medical needs. This distinction highlights different models of accessibility and purpose within the stem cell banking sector.

The stem cell umbilical cord blood market plays a crucial role in treating various conditions, including cancer and oncology diseases. Applications extend to chronic leukemia, myelodysplastic syndrome, and blood disorders such as beta thalassemia and sickle cell disease. Additionally, it offers potential treatments for rare genetic conditions like Wiskott-Aldrich, Hurler syndrome, and Sanfilippo syndrome. These stem cells are valuable for regenerative medicine and transplantation, providing a source of hematopoietic stem cells that can restore healthy blood cell production in affected patients.
